There is more than one author on Goodreads with the name Christopher Wright.

Christopher Wright is the author of dozens of horror fiction books for children and young adults. He writes under the pseudonyms Johnathan Rand and Christopher Knight. Almost all of Wright's books (save American Chillers) take place in his home state of Michigan.

“The exodus was not a movement from slavery to freedom, but from slavery to covenant. Redemption was for relationship with the redeemer, to serve his interests and his purposes in the world.”
Christopher Wright, The Mission of God's People: A Biblical Theology of the Church’s Mission

“When I’ve been teaching for a while, I sometimes stop abruptly and say, «you know, something very strange happened while I was on my journey here today.» Immediately people look up and take an interest. They want to know what happened. They want to hear the story. I usually then dissapoint them by saying, «Actually, nothing happened. But I notice how interested you all became when you though I was going to tell you a story.. That shows how powerful stories are in engaging attention. That’s why God gave us so many stories in the Bible. God knows how to get our attention.»”
Christopher Wright, How to preach the Old Testament
